Minneapolis Area Synod seeks accountant

The Minneapolis Area Synod is seeking an accountant to begin by July 15. The primary functions of this position include preparation of monthly financial statements and other reports, maintenance of accounts and payroll, and preparation of the annual audit.


To apply, submit a letter of application, résumé, and the names of three references electronically to Jessie Goeke or to her attention using the synod address.

Exploring personal and communal boundaries

The Saint Paul Area Synod is offering continuing education that includes boundary training workshops. Pastors and deacons are required to participate in boundary training at least once every five years. This in-person workshop will cover foundational understandings of boundaries and power along with conversation about harassment, mandated reporting and self-care, as well as a deep dive into implicit bias.


Thursday, April 25 9:00 a.m. - 3:00 p.m.

St. Michael's Lutheran Church

1660 West County Road B, Roseville


Presenters include Deacon Krista Lind and Bishop Patricia Lull from the Saint Paul Area Synod and Anna Stamborski from Faith and Prejudice. This workshop is open to rostered ministers from any ELCA synod. The cost is $40, which includes lunch. Registration is required.

Duke Divinity offers leadership grants

The Reflective Leadership Grant from Duke Divinity School supports an opportunity for structured reflection for lay or clergy leaders of Christian organizations that are advancing their mission following the multiple pandemics — COVID-19, racial inequity, economic disruption and mental distress — that emerged and/or intensified throughout the past few years.



This grant aims to support those leaders whose work has made a demonstrable contribution to their organization's mission. These leaders are at a pivotal moment for stepping back and reflecting on what has been accomplished, what is changing, and what is stable. The Reflective Leadership Grant allows leaders to broaden their perspectives and gain clarity about what needs to happen next in their personal and professional life.

"God's Work. Our Hands. Sunday" set for September 8

Mark your calendar for Sunday, September 8, when congregations of the ELCA will join together for the ELCA's annual day of service, “God’s work. Our hands.” Participating in service projects is one way to celebrate who we are as the ELCA — one church, freed in Christ to serve and love our neighbor.


This year the ELCA also celebrates 50 years of ELCA World Hunger. In commemoration of this milestone, consider including ministries focused on alleviating hunger and poverty in your plans for “God’s work. Our hands.” Or make it a season of service! Expand your volunteer opportunities, advocacy efforts, or food drives until World Food Day on October 16.



If your congregation cannot participate on September 8, you are encouraged to pick another date that fits your schedule. ELCA congregations participate in acts of service every day. This day of service is an extension of the work you already do to make your community a better place. Be sure to save the date and check ELCA.org/DayOfService for updated resources soon.
